Bug description:
  We are using Ubuntu in a university network with lots of ldap users.
  To automatically map ldap users/groups to local groups we are using
  pam_group.so. This has worked for years.

  With the upgrade from Xenial to Bionic /etc/security/group.conf is not
  evaluated anymore by gnome-terminal as it runs as systemd --user.
  Xterm, ssh, su, and tty* however do work as expected. Only the default
  gnome-terminal behaves different.

  According to https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=851243
  and https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=756458 this
  might not be a bug, but a feature.

  Nevertheless this behavior is very unexpected when upgrading from
  Xenial to Bionic and therefore should at least added to the changelog.
